Foundation Jacking Services
Foundation jacking is a process used to stabilize and lift a building’s foundation that has shifted or settled unevenly over time. This technique involves inserting hydraulic jacks beneath the foundation to carefully raise it back to its proper level. The procedure typically includes installing support systems, such as steel piers or beams, which transfer the load to more stable soil or bedrock beneath the structure. Foundation jacking is often selected as a solution when uneven settling causes structural issues, cracks, or misaligned door and window frames.
This service addresses common foundation problems caused by soil movement, erosion, or changes in moisture levels. When a foundation sinks or tilts, it can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, and compromised structural integrity. Foundation jacking helps to correct these issues by realigning the building, reducing stress on the structure, and preventing further damage. It can also mitigate safety concerns associated with foundation instability, helping to preserve the overall stability of the property.
Properties that typically utilize foundation jacking include residential homes, especially those built on expansive or shifting soils, as well as comm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es. Older structures that have experienced settling over decades may require this service to restore stability. Additionally, properties in areas prone to soil movement, such as regions with high clay content or frequent moisture fluctuations, are often candidates for foundation jacking to maintain safety and functionality.

Foundation Jacking Cost - The typical cost range for foundation jacking services varies from $3,000 to $15,000, depending on the extent of the work and the size of the structure. Smaller residential projects may be closer to the lower end, while larger or more complex jobs tend to be on the higher end.
Labor and Equipment Fees - Labor costs for foundation jacking generally account for 50% to 70% of the total project price, with service providers charging between $75 and $150 per hour. Specialized equipment rental fees can add several thousand dollars to the overall cost, especially for extensive lifting operations.
Material and Material Handling - The cost of materials such as underpinning piers, jacks, and stabilizers can range from $500 to $3,000 per project, depending on the number needed. Additional expenses may include transportation and handling fees for heavy equipment and materials to the job site.
Additional Service Expenses - Extra costs may include site preparation, inspection, and post-lifting stabilization, which can add $1,000 to $5,000 to the total. These services ensure the foundation’s stability and may vary based on local contractor rates and project compl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foundation jacking? Foundation jacking is a process used to lift and stabilize a settling or uneven building foundation by using hydraulic or mechanical tools to raise the structure back to its proper level.
When is foundation jacking needed? Foundation jacking may be necessary when signs of settling, such as cracks in walls or uneven floors, are observed in a building's foundation.
How do local pros perform foundation jacking? Professionals typically use hydraulic jacks and underpinning techniques to carefully lift and support the foundation, ensuring stability and safety.
Is foundation jacking a permanent solution? Foundation jacking can provide a long-lasting correction when performed properly, but addressing underlying soil or drainage issues may be necessary to prevent future settlement.
